I've had a P9 Lite for about 7 months. For file transferring, I've never bothered with any of the included software, have rather used the method of plugging it in, swiping down the notification area and selecting files, so it works like a flashdrive.
However, yesterday I had it plugged in, used it, unplugged it. A little while later, plugged it back in... and nothing. It charges (takes a few seconds to register now) but doesn't appear connected to my PC at all (Windows 10). The option to select 'files' no longer appears, and it doesn't register in My Computer. As far as I know, I didn't do anything at all in my phone to change any USB options.
I've tried using the *#*#2846579#*#* code and fiddling with the USB options, have tried multiple cables which work with a friend's P9 Lite, different PCs, but nothing.
Is there anything I'm potentially missing? I've heard the other option would be to do a Factory Reset... If that is the last option I'll try it. However, as I'm a bit of an Android noob, would I have to back my phone up before doing this? I can't backup via USB now, so any recommendations for a backup program that would restore my phone exactly as it is after a reset?
